Title: Innovations by Gilbert Wellisch
Introduction
Gilbert Wellisch is a notable inventor based in Midvale, UT (US). He has made significant contributions to the field of wireless communication security, holding 2 patents that address critical issues in WLAN security.
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is titled "System and method for providing WLAN security through synchronized update and rotation of WEP keys." This invention overcomes deficiencies in prior art IEEE 802.11 WEP key management schemes. The preferred embodiments of this system update WEP keys and rotate transmission key indices in a synchronized manner and on a frequent basis. This approach makes it impractical for hackers to gather sufficient network traffic using any one WEP key to decrypt that key, all while maintaining uninterrupted communications. Importantly, this system does not require changes in access point or mobile unit hardware, radio drivers, or firmware, making it compatible with existing or legacy network infrastructure.
